Frequently Asked Questions
Get answers to common questions about LED Light Therapy for Skin.
Most clients experience no pain; treatments feel like gentle warmth. We provide eye protection and adjust intensity for comfort. It's safe for sensitive skin, though mild tingling or temporary redness can occur in rare cases.
Treatment plans vary, but most benefit from 6–10 sessions scheduled weekly or biweekly. Maintenance sessions every 4–8 weeks help sustain results. Your practitioner creates a personalized plan based on skin goals and response.
Many clients notice subtle improvements in skin glow and texture after two to four sessions, with firmer, more defined results appearing after continued treatment as collagen production increases over several weeks.
LED therapy is safe for most skin types and tones because it doesn't use UV. However, people taking photosensitizing medications, pregnant individuals, or those with specific medical conditions should consult our clinician before treatment.
Yes — LED Light Therapy for Skin complements facials, microneedling, and many injectables when timed correctly. We coordinate treatment sequencing to maximize healing, minimize irritation, and enhance overall results tailored to your skin and goals.
Side effects are uncommon and usually mild — temporary redness, increased warmth, or dryness. There is no significant downtime; resume normal activities immediately. If you experience persistent irritation, blistering, or unusual symptoms, contact our clinic promptly.
